Our Island Home: The shifting map of Australian literature. This project will provide the first full-length study of the ways Australia's unique status as an island continent has shaped its national literature. Understanding this relationship will re-define the borders of its literature in three ways: it will establish new connections within the national literature between the literature of the mainland and surrounding islands; it will identify why certain regions such as the continental interior and outlying islands capture the literary imagination at particular times; it will bring to light ways for Australian literature to position itself within the shifting geographies of globalised modernity.
